Werner Forssman, was born in Berlin on August 20, 1904. He graduated in medicine in 1928. He developed a theory that no one would accept: that would be possible to introduce a probe intravenously and bring it to the inside of the heart without killing the patient. Obviously could not use corpses, since they were already dead. He tried to authorization of his superiors at the hospital to carry out experiments on a patient. Of course that was not authorized. So can not use human subjects, used his own body.
He cut a vein in the arm and introduced a catheter (a catheter is the correct pronunciation and not catheter) and was pushing it until it reached the heart organ. To prove that he had achieved and that this procedure did not kill the patient, went to the x-ray room and, over the protests of his colleagues, took a picture. It was undeniable! None could question his discovery that would save many lives worldwide. His reward? It was so punished, criticized and attacked who dropped cardiology!
For over two decades was not invited to anything and if he dared to attend a congress had to suffer the embarrassment of being appointed by his peers as an undesirable. After 25 years of humiliation and exclusion, finally, recognition. In 1956, he received the Nobel Prize in Medicine.
